a 4oz Farewell
dark rinsed veins drain to the brain, a throbbing tiredness drives me to well up hide against the wall refrigerator buzz, paper towel covering a runny nose in case someone walks in ignorance, a few feet away. paunchy eyes; silk streams glistening onto chewed up finger nails, a silent sort of death unnoticeable serene, as I clutch my mouth and the kitchen counter top.
